55 /*******************************************************************************
56 *
57 * FUNCTION: acpi_ut_mutex_initialize
58 *
59 * PARAMETERS: None.
60 *
61 * RETURN: Status
62 *
63 * DESCRIPTION: Create the system mutex objects. This includes mutexes,
64 * spin locks, and reader/writer locks.
65 *
66 ******************************************************************************/
67
68 acpi_status acpi_ut_mutex_initialize(void)
69 {
70 u32 i;
71 acpi_status status;
72
73 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E(ut_mutex_initialize);
74
75 /* Create each of the predefined mutex objects */
76
77 for (i = 0; i < ACPI_NUM_MUTEX; i++) {
78 status = acpi_ut_create_mutex(i);
79 if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) {
80 return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
81 }
82 }
83
84 /* Create the spinlocks for use at interrupt level */
85
86 spin_lock_init(acpi_gbl_gpe_lock);
87 spin_lock_init(acpi_gbl_hardware_lock);
88
89 /* Mutex for _OSI support */
90 status = acpi_os_create_mutex(&acpi_gbl_osi_mutex);
91 if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) {
92 return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
93 }
94
95 /* Create the reader/writer lock for namespace access */
96
97 status = acpi_ut_create_rw_lock(&acpi_gbl_namespace_rw_lock);
98 return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
99 }

190
191 /*******************************************************************************
192 *
193 * FUNCTION: acpi_ut_acquire_mutex
194 *
195 * PARAMETERS: mutex_iD - ID of the mutex to be acquired
196 *
197 * RETURN: Status
198 *
199 * DESCRIPTION: Acquire a mutex object.
200 *
201 ******************************************************************************/
202
203 acpi_status acpi_ut_acquire_mutex(acpi_mutex_handle mutex_id)
204 {
205 acpi_status status;
206 acpi_thread_id this_thread_id;
207
208 ACPI_FUNCTION_NAME(ut_acquire_mutex);
209
210 if (mutex_id > ACPI_MAX_MUTEX) {
211 return (AE_BAD_PARAMETER);
212 }
213
214 this_thread_id = acpi_os_get_thread_id();
215
216 #ifdef ACPI_MUTEX_DEBUG
217 {
218 u32 i;
219 /*
220 * Mutex debug code, for internal debugging only.
221 *
222 * Deadlock prevention. Check if this thread owns any mutexes of value
223 * greater than or equal to this one. If so, the thread has violated
224 * the mutex ordering rule. This indicates a coding error somewhere in
225 * the ACPI subsystem code.
226 */
227 for (i = mutex_id; i < ACPI_NUM_MUTEX; i++) {
228 if (acpi_gbl_mutex_info[i].thread_id == this_thread_id) {
229 if (i == mutex_id) {
230 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O,
231 "Mutex [%s] already acquired by this thread [%p]",
232 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name
233 (mutex_id),
234 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void,
235 this_thread_id)));
236
237 return (AE_ALREADY_ACQUIRED);
238 }
239
240 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O,
241 "Invalid acquire order: Thread %p owns [%s], wants [%s]",
242 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void, this_thread_id),
243 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(i),
244 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(mutex_id)));
245
246 return (AE_ACQUIRE_DEADLOCK);
247 }
248 }
249 }
250 #endif
251
252 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_MUTEX,
253 "Thread %p attempting to acquire Mutex [%s]\n",
254 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void, this_thread_id),
255 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(mutex_id)));
256
257 status = acpi_os_acquire_mutex(ac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].mutex,
258 ACPI_WAIT_FOREVER);
259 if (ACPI_SUCCESS(status)) {
260 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_MUTEX,
261 "Thread %p acquired Mutex [%s]\n",
262 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void, this_thread_id),
263 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(mutex_id)));
264
265 ac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].use_count++;
266 ac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].thread_id = this_thread_id;
267 } else {
268 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status,
269 "Thread %p could not acquire Mutex [0x%X]",
270 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void, this_thread_id), mutex_id));
271 }
272
273 return (status);
274 }
275
276 /*******************************************************************************
277 *
278 * FUNCTION: acpi_ut_release_mutex
279 *
280 * PARAMETERS: mutex_iD - ID of the mutex to be released
281 *
282 * RETURN: Status
283 *
284 * DESCRIPTION: Release a mutex object.
285 *
286 ******************************************************************************/
287
288 acpi_status acpi_ut_release_mutex(acpi_mutex_handle mutex_id)
289 {
290 ACPI_FUNCTION_NAME(ut_release_mutex);
291
292 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_MUTEX, "Thread %p releasing Mutex [%s]\n",
293 ACPI_CAST_PTR(void, acpi_os_get_thread_id()),
294 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(mutex_id)));
295
296 if (mutex_id > ACPI_MAX_MUTEX) {
297 return (AE_BAD_PARAMETER);
298 }
299
300 /*
301 * Mutex must be acquired in order to release it!
302 */
303 if (ac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].thread_id == ACPI_MUTEX_NOT_ACQUIRED) {
304 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O,
305 "Mutex [0x%X] is not acquired, cannot release",
306 mutex_id));
307
308 return (AE_NOT_ACQUIRED);
309 }
310 #ifdef ACPI_MUTEX_DEBUG
311 {
312 u32 i;
313 /*
314 * Mutex debug code, for internal debugging only.
315 *
316 * Deadlock prevention. Check if this thread owns any mutexes of value
317 * greater than this one. If so, the thread has violated the mutex
318 * ordering rule. This indicates a coding error somewhere in
319 * the ACPI subsystem code.
320 */
321 for (i = mutex_id; i < ACPI_NUM_MUTEX; i++) {
322 if (acpi_gbl_mutex_info[i].thread_id == this_thread_id) {
323 if (i == mutex_id) {
324 continue;
325 }
326
327 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O,
328 "Invalid release order: owns [%s], releasing [%s]",
329 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(i),
330 acpi_ut_get_mutex_name(mutex_id)));
331
332 return (AE_RELEASE_DEADLOCK);
333 }
334 }
335 }
336 #endif
337
338 /* Mark unlocked FIRST */
339
340 ac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].thread_id = ACPI_MUTEX_NOT_ACQUIRED;
341
342 acpi_os_release_mutex(acpi_gbl_mutex_info[mutex_id].mutex);
343 return (AE_OK);
344 }
